Overview
Foreign nationals can go to Nigeria for leisure, sightseeing, or brief visits with friends and relatives using a Nigeria tourist visa. A valid passport, travel arrangements, and evidence of cash are among the prerequisites that applicants must fulfill.

Documents Required
Per Traveller
Passport: Data page (min 6 months validity)
RequiredPhoto: Digital passport-size photograph
RequiredFlight: Proof of return ticket.
RequiredStay: Hotel booking or Host address
RequiredFunds: Bank statement (last 180 days)
